Did MN SF 565 pass?

No. MN SF 565 died when the 2025-2026 session adjourned without final action on it. Bills that die this way are sometimes reintroduced in a later session. Latest recorded action (2025-03-10): Comm report: To pass and re-referred to Health and Human Services

What is MN SF 565 about?

MN SF 565 is a bill in the 2025-2026 titled “Cost defrayal to health plan companies for additional benefits by the commissioner of commerce requirement”.

Who sponsors MN SF 565?

Frentz is the primary sponsor of MN SF 565, joined by 2 cosponsors.
